SQ port = tunning lower 25 hz or so , and tunning lower means more port length,port will be too long,

more port length = more port vol.

more port vol. = less internal enclosure vol.

that will end up with a negative enclosure net vol.

then u need to build a bigger enclosure for more internal vol.

tunning higher will decrease the port lenght

decreasing the port area will decrease port length.
